Pretty Boy Floyd by split decision.


Yesterday was presented at the MGM Grand in Las Vegas the awaited WBO Junior Middleweight championship fight between Oscar De la Hoya and Floyd Mayweather jr. The fight was not as exciting as it promised in part because Mayweather used his defensive elusiveness and speed on the outside to register the win.

According to the three judges, Pretty Boy Floyd did just enough to win the bout. Two judges gave the advantage to Mayweather by 116-112 and 115-113 as a third one gave the victory to De la Hoya by 115-113. With this title, Mayweather wins a world championship in a 5th different weight class.

After the fight, Mayweather said to Larry Merchant that he could retire, still undefeated, but also said to ESPN that if De la Hoya wanted a rematch he could grant that rematch. I think that we could see a rematch. De la Hoya was probably the best opponent that Pretty Boy Floyd faced in his career. Oscar should logically ask for revenge and have another shot at Mayweather and his perfect record.
